When Your Mom Is Famous for Hating Motherhood
Briefly

As a child often written about in her mother Erica Jong's and grandfather Howard Fast's works, the author shares mixed feelings on the topic, acknowledging the impact on her career and personal life.
The novel 'The Mother Act' explores the complex relationship between a mother, Sadie, who writes about her feelings on motherhood in a play, and her daughter Jude, focusing on themes of abandonment, betrayal, and reshaping lives.
